Really depends on the application as what line is the best. I was a fishing guide in ak for over ten years and have used it all. Imo, and that is what it comes down to is opinion, braids (Tuffline or Power Pro are my favs) are the best for bottom fishing as you can feel every rock and nibble, even 400 feet down. If you need to set the hook at that depth, you can. Impossible with mono cause of the line stretch. Mono is the way to go when trolling for salmon. The stretch actually helps you keep more fish on da hook as salmon have relatively soft mouths.

All and all it depends what you want to go for and how you are going for it.
